https://gcc.gnu.org/bugzilla/show_bug.cgi?id=65654
Bug ID: 65654 Summary: [5 Regression] 447.dealII in SPEC CPU 2006 failed to build with LTO Product: gcc Version: 5.0 Status: UNCONFIRMED Severity: normal Priority: P3 Component: ipa Assignee: unassigned at gcc dot gnu.org Reporter: hjl.tools at gmail dot com CC: hubicka at ucw dot cz On Linux/x86-64, r221769 caused: g++ -O3 -funroll-loops -ffast-math -fwhole-program -flto=jobserver -fuse-linker-plugin -DSPEC_CPU_LP64 auto_derivative_function.o block_sparse_matrix.o block_sparse_matrix_ez.o block_sparsity_pattern.o block_vector.o compressed_sparsity_pattern.o data_out.o data_out_base.o data_out_faces.o data_out_rotation.o data_out_stack.o derivative_approximation.o dof_accessor.o dof_constraints.o dof_handler.o dof_levels.o dof_renumbering.o dof_tools.o error_estimator.o exceptions.o fe.o fe_data.o fe_dgp.o fe_dgp_1d.o fe_dgp_2d.o fe_dgp_3d.o fe_dgp_nonparametric.o fe_dgq.o fe_dgq_1d.o fe_dgq_2d.o fe_dgq_3d.o fe_nedelec.o fe_nedelec_1d.o fe_nedelec_2d.o fe_nedelec_3d.o fe_q.o fe_q_1d.o fe_q_2d.o fe_q_3d.o fe_q_hierarchical.o fe_raviart_thomas.o fe_system.o fe_tools.o fe_values.o filtered_matrix.o full_matrix.double.o full_matrix.float.o function.o function_derivative.o function_lib.o function_lib_cutoff.o function_time.o geometry_info.o grid_generator.o grid_in.o grid_out.all_dimensions.o grid_out.o grid_refinement.o grid_reordering.o histogram.o intergrid_map.o job_identifier.o log.o mapping.o mapping_c1.o mapping_cartesian.o mapping_q.o mapping_q1.o mapping_q1_eulerian.o matrices.all_dimensions.o matrices.o matrix_lib.o matrix_out.o memory_consumption.o mg_base.o mg_dof_accessor.o mg_dof_handler.o mg_dof_tools.o mg_smoother.o mg_transfer_block.o mg_transfer_prebuilt.o mg_transfer_block.all_dimensions.o multigrid.all_dimensions.o multithread_info.o parameter_handler.o persistent_tria.o polynomial.o polynomial_space.o programid.o quadrature.o quadrature_lib.o solution_transfer.o solver_control.o sparse_matrix.double.o sparse_matrix.float.o sparse_matrix_ez.double.o sparse_matrix_ez.float.o sparsity_pattern.o step-14.o subscriptor.o swappable_vector.o tensor.o tensor_product_polynomials.o tria.all_dimensions.o tria.o tria_accessor.o tria_boundary.o tria_boundary_lib.o vector.o vector.long_double.o vectors.all_dimensions.o fe_dgp_monomial.o fe_poly.o polynomials_bdm.o polynomials_p.o vectors.o -o dealII lto1: internal compiler error: in inline_call, at ipa-inline-transform.c:386 Please submit a full bug report, with preprocessed source if appropriate. See <http://gcc.gnu.org/bugs.html> for instructions. lto-wrapper: fatal error: g++ returned 1 exit status compilation terminated. /usr/local/bin/ld: error: lto-wrapper failed collect2: error: ld returned 1 exit status specmake: *** [dealII] Error 1